Cavuto questioned Thomas Massie about another Republican calling the Speaker removal attempt a 'clown show'

Neil Cavuto confronted Rep. Thomas Massie (R-KY) Saturday about a fellow Republican denouncing the “clown show” effort to oust the House Speaker.

Fox News’ Neil Cavuto confronted Rep. Thomas Massie (R-KY) Saturday with comments from fellow Republican Rep. Mike Lawler (R-NY) denouncing the effort to oust Republican Speaker Mike Johnson as a “clown show.”

Massie joined reps. Marjorie Taylor Greene (R-GA) and Paul Gosar (R-AZ) this week in calling for the most recent Republican Speaker to step down for a variety of reasons, including working with the Democrats to pass a foreign aid bill.

Cavuto played the clip of Lawler earlier on the show trashing the move as “a continuation of the clown show.”

Lawler continued, “Speaker Johnson, like speaker McCarthy before him, is doing the right thing by putting critical legislation on the floor in favor of the American people, and in favor of America’s role in the world.”

Cavuto said, “So, he’s saying you’re part of a clown show. I wanted to give you the opportunity to respond.”

“One thing about, you know, we need to remind Mike Lawler is, he led the effort to get rid of George Santos,” Massie said.And I think that was a bit of a…unwise, very unwise move. It shrunk our majority and we saw that seat replaced by a Democrat. So, I don’t think he’s got the best take on what we need to be doing here in Congress to keep our majority.”

Cavuto asked, “There is a big difference between someone like a George Santos, a serial liar, and Mike Johnson, whatever your differences? Right? I mean, a slight difference.”

“Well, the thing is, George Santos wasn’t convicted of anything — we threw him out. And I would rather have a Republican with a cloud over than a Democrat in that seat because it, frankly, the majority, you know, relies on it, and Mike Lawler got rid of George Santos. Mike Johnson was part…Mike Johnson did nothing to stop that effort and I think that’s another reason Mike Johnson needs to go,” Massie said.
